Alpena is a North American-based company that has specialized in aftermarket automotive accessories for over 45 years, with a current focus on auxiliary, off-road and accent LED lighting. Established in 1976, their brands are well-known players in the CPG (consumer packaged goods) industry. Automotive enthusiasts rave over their wide selection of products that provide high-quality user experience and product performance, for value pricing.

This company works at a fast pace and is focused on not only maintaining its presence in the aftermarket automotive world but also looking to shift gears and grow. All of this is accomplished by a team of very skilled, passionate, and committed individuals who are self-driven and motivated. **E-commerce/Digital Marketing Specialist**

**Summary of role**:

- Collaborate with the Senior Management team and 3rd party consulting team to lead, develop, and execute a comprehensive digital marketing strategy to drive online sales, increase brand awareness, and achieve ROI targets.
- 60% focus on B2C e-commerce marketing operations and 40% cross-functional support on our retail marketing needs

**Responsibilities**:
**1. Digital Marketing Strategy**:

- Identify target audiences, market trends, and emerging opportunities.

**2. SEO & SEM**
- Conduct keyword research and analysis and share with the Product and Sales Team
- Optimize website content, meta tags, and on-page elements for improved search engine rankings.
- Optimize ad copy, keywords, and bid strategies.
- Create and manage pay-per-click (PPC) advertising campaigns on platforms.
- Monitor and report on SEO and Campaign performance.
- Plan and implement paid social media advertising campaigns on platforms like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, and LinkedIn.
- Ensure content is optimized for SEO and aligned with marketing goals and track content engagement and performance.

**4. E-commerce Marketing Operations Management**
- Monitor and analyze website traffic, user behavior, and conversion rates using analytics tools and identify improvement areas
- Manage product listings, descriptions, pricing, and inventory on the e-commerce platform.
- Collaborate with the team to improve the user experience and website functionality.
- Conduct competitor analysis to identify strengths and weaknesses.
- Stay updated on digital marketing trends, search engine algorithms, and industry best practices.
- Ensure compliance with data protection and privacy regulations.

5. **Customer Experience Management**
- Showcase positive feedback / Generate insights from customer reviews / maintain customer satisfaction by managing customer interactions.
- Navigate and manage customer experience insights.

**Qualifications**:

-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Business, or a related field
- Proven experience in digital marketing, particularly in e-commerce environments.
- Strong analytical skills and experience with analytics tools.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
- Familiarity with e-commerce platforms and content management systems.
- Knowledge of HTML, CSS, and web development basics.
- Google Ads and other digital marketing certifications are a plus.
- Results-driven mindset with a focus on ROI and data-driven decision-making.
